RegExr: Free Online RegEx Testing Tool

Thursday, March 27th, 2008 - 7:42 am

RegExr provides a simple interface to enter RegEx expressions, and visualize matches in real-time editable source text. It also provides a handy RegExp snippet sidebar with descriptions and usage examples to make it easier to learn Regular Expressions through trial and error.
